EmfDesignVector
Inheritance: java.lang.Object, com.aspose.imaging.fileformats.emf.MetaObject, com.aspose.imaging.fileformats.emf.emf.objects.EmfObject
public final class EmfDesignVector extends EmfObject
Объект DesignVector (раздел 2.2.3) определяет вектор дизайна, который задает значения осей шрифта многомастерового шрифта.
Конструкторы
| Конструктор | Описание |
|---|---|
| EmfDesignVector() |
Методы
| Метод | Описание |
|---|---|
| getSignature() | Получает или задает 32-битное беззнаковое целое, которое ДОЛЖНО быть установлено в значение 0x08007664. |
| setSignature(int value) | Получает или задает 32-битное беззнаковое целое, которое ДОЛЖНО быть установлено в значение 0x08007664. |
| getNumAxes() | Получает или задает 32-битное беззнаковое целое, которое указывает количество элементов в массиве Values. |
| setNumAxes(int value) | Получает или задает 32-битное беззнаковое целое, которое указывает количество элементов в массиве Values. |
| getValues() | Получает или задает необязательный массив 32-битных знаковых целых, который указывает значения осей шрифта многомастерного шрифта OpenType. |
| setValues(int[] value) | Получает или задает необязательный массив 32-битных знаковых целых, который указывает значения осей шрифта многомастерного шрифта OpenType. |
EmfDesignVector()
public EmfDesignVector()
getSignature()
public int getSignature()
Получает или задает 32-битное беззнаковое целое, которое ДОЛЖНО быть установлено в значение 0x08007664.
Returns: int
setSignature(int value)
public void setSignature(int value)
Получает или задает 32-битное беззнаковое целое, которое ДОЛЖНО быть установлено в значение 0x08007664.
Parameters:
| Параметр | Тип | Описание |
|---|---|---|
| value | int |
getNumAxes()
public int getNumAxes()
Получает или задает 32-битное беззнаковое целое, которое указывает количество элементов в массиве Values. Оно ДОЛЖНО находиться в диапазоне от 0 до 16 включительно.
Returns: int
setNumAxes(int value)
public void setNumAxes(int value)
Получает или задает 32-битное беззнаковое целое, которое указывает количество элементов в массиве Values. Оно ДОЛЖНО находиться в диапазоне от 0 до 16 включительно.
Parameters:
| Параметр | Тип | Описание |
|---|---|---|
| value | int |
getValues()
public int[] getValues()
Получает или задает необязательный массив 32-битных знаковых целых, который указывает значения осей шрифта многомастерного шрифта OpenType. Максимальное количество значений в массиве — 16.
Returns: int[]
setValues(int[] value)
public void setValues(int[] value)
Получает или задает необязательный массив 32-битных знаковых целых, который указывает значения осей шрифта многомастерного шрифта OpenType. Максимальное количество значений в массиве — 16.
Parameters:
| Параметр | Тип | Описание |
|---|---|---|
| value | int[] |